100% Bonus Depreciation Is Now Permanent: What It Means for Recycling Equipment Buyers

Recent changes to federal tax law have created a major opportunity for businesses planning to invest in recycling and waste handling equipment. With the permanent extension of 100% bonus depreciation, companies can now fully deduct the cost of qualifying equipment in the year it is placed into service.
